Changed defaults in Splitfork, our assignment service. Bucketing now uses sticky hashing per account instead of per session, and the holdout slice grew from 2% to 5%. Callers relying on session-level reassignment must opt in explicitly. Review the diff against the new baseline; the updated default configuration is listed below.

config for tagep-kajof:
[casir]
port = 6379
region = south-1
host = casir.paliqdyn.example
team = tamax
timeout_ms = 250
retries = 2

Handover note — Crumbwheel order cutoffs.

Welcome aboard. The bakery cutoff rule in Crumbwheel closes same-day orders at 14:00 local to each storefront, not UTC — this has bitten us twice. Holiday overrides live in the calendar service and take precedence silently, so always check there first when a cutoff looks wrong. To unlock the calendar service's admin console after a restart, enter the recovery passphrase below.

vault phrase of bagap-bahaf = silion-pelox-sorox-casdor-quenwyn-fraax-eliox-praael-kelion-quenvan-kasox-rusael-norius-belvan

MEMO — Incoming Director

Summary on the Brightmoor pilot: churn hit 14% in month three, double forecast. Exit interviews point to onboarding gaps, not product faults. Retention fixes from the Solvane team reduced week-over-week losses, but the cohort is thin and confidence is low. Recommend extending the pilot one quarter before any scale decision. Budget impact is minor. Context on where this sits strategically is set out below.

board note of kageg-bahof: The renewal with Holwynax Holdings closes at $2 million a year, 5 percent below the last contract. Project Ulaath slips by two quarters because of the supplier delay.

Changed defaults, on-call folks, so read this one. The loyalty-points ledger now batches accrual writes every 500ms instead of per-transaction, which cuts write load roughly 60% but means balances can lag by up to a second. Alerts tuned accordingly — don't panic at small transient mismatches between the ledger and the rewards cache; they self-heal. Reversals still apply synchronously. If a batch flush fails three times, the service halts accruals and pages you. The new defaults ship as the following configuration values.

settings of hagug-fawip:
BRIWYN_LOG_LEVEL=warn
BRIWYN_METRICS_HOST=metrics.briwyn.qorvelsys.internal
BRIWYN_POOL_SIZE=8